Calories in WISCONSIN CHEESE SOUP, WISCONSIN CHEESE

Serving Size: 1 cup (245.0g)
Amount Per Serving
  • Calories 178.9
  • Total Fat 8.0 g
  • Saturated Fat 4.5 g
  • Cholesterol 19.6 mg
  • Sodium 1158.9 mg
  • Potassium 308.7 mg
  • Total Carbohydrate 17.0 g
  • Dietary Fiber 0.0 g
  • Sugars 8.0 g
  • Protein 9.0 g

Ingredients

WATER, PASTEURIZED PROCESSED CHEESE SPREAD (AMERICAN CHEESE [PASTEURIZED MILK, CHEESE CULTURE, SALT, ENZYMES], WATER, WHEY, SODIUM PHOSPHATE, WHEY PROTEIN CONCENTRATE, SKIM MILK, MILKFAT, ARTIFICIAL COLOR), NONFAT DRY MILK, FOOD STARCH-MODIFIED, CELERY, FLOUR (BLEACHED WHEAT FLOUR, POTASSIUM BROMATE, ENZYME), PARMESAN CHEESE (PASTEURIZED PART-SKIM MILK, SALT, ENZYMES, CHEESE CULTURES, CORNSTARCH AND POWDERED CELLULOSE TO PREVENT CAKING, POTASSIUM SORBATE), CHEESE POWDER BLEND (WHEY SOLIDS, MILKFAT, WHEY PROTEIN CONCENTRATE, SALT, CORN SYRUP SOLIDS, NONFAT MILK, CHEESE [PASTEURIZED MILK, CULTURES, SALT, ENZYMES], DISODIUM PHOSPHATE, LACTIC ACID, CITRIC ACID), RENDERED BACON FAT, GREEN BELL PEPPER, BACON (CURED WITH WATER, SALT, SUGAR, SMOKE FLAVORING, SODIUM PHOSPHATES, SODIUM ERYTHORBATE, SODIUM NITRITE), SALT, DEHYDRATED ONION, SUGAR, YEAST EXTRACT, HYDROLYZED CORN PROTEIN (HYDROLYZED CORN PROTEIN WITH SUNFLOWER OIL ADDED), TURMERIC POWDER (SALT, OLEORESIN TURMERIC [COLOR]), CHICKEN FAT FLAVOR (HYDROLYZED CORN GLUTEN, SALT, MALTODEXTRIN, CHICKEN FAT, SODIUM PHOSPHATE, SPICES, SUGAR, NATURAL FLAVORS, DISODIUM INOSINATE, DISODIUM GUANYLATE), CARROT POWDER (SALT, OLEORESIN CARROT [COLOR]), ORANGE FOOD COLOR (YELLOW #5 AND 6, CITRIC ACID, SODIUM BENZOATE, RED #40), GARLIC, PARSLEY, LIQUID SMOKE (WATER, NATURAL HICKORY SMOKE FLAVOR, MOLASSES, CARAMEL COLOR, WHITE DISTILLED VINEGAR, SULFITES).

Calorie Analysis

The food WISCONSIN CHEESE SOUP, WISCONSIN CHEESE, based on the serving size listed above, would account for 8.9% of your daily allotted calories based on a 2,000 calorie diet. The majority of the calories for this food comes from fat. Fat makes up 40.3% of the calories.
